Re: Ju88 loss, 25 May 1941?
The ./506 KTB gives 25/26 May: Löhr should have returned in the early hours of 26 May - but didn't. His task was to patrol Newcastle-Whitby, which makes me wonder whether the Ju88 did crash off the Norfolk coast. There is the likelihood that Uffz H. Biesterfeld, listed in Blitz vol.3 p35 and in the IWGC list of German War Graves in the UK as being buried in St Mary's churchyard, Great Bircham, Norfolk, was a member of Löhr's crew - though the KTB gives Uffz Paul Biesterfeld. If they are one and the same, and given that Biesterfeld was buried under the date 29 June 1941, I suspect that Biesterfeld's corpse had been at sea for some time and had drifted south to the point where it was eventually found.
